Post by Fireworm Mon Mar 05, 2012 6:04 pm

Well you see, mine isn't in archives so they are accessible to edit on the spot. All I have to do is drag x tweak (x being unknown, because it depends on the tweak) into x folder and replace the other file.

A .xom archive decompliler hasn't been made afaik, it's probably going to have to be to be able to do anything. :/

What version are you using, and how is your folder layed out (if there is one) inside the Worms 4 Mayhem folder? For mine, inside the W4M folder there is a folder called data which contains the savegame and all the folders containing everything else.

Post by Fireworm Mon Mar 26, 2012 1:37 pm

If it was a month ago I would of said Vista, but I am currently using W7. The computer shouldn't matter when relating to game files though.

To check, find your setup (usually found on the CD). Right click it and go into properties, then go to the "details" tab. It will tell you the version and last date modified there.

Post by Dzani Sun Apr 01, 2012 12:29 pm

I think you are trying to open DATA 1 and DATA 2 from a DVD. You cant tweak game on a DVD. You must Install it, and locate the installation folder. That is where you install the tweaks.

Post by Dzani Sun Apr 01, 2012 6:17 pm

Why would you that ? If you want to tweak go to your installation folder and copy tweaks there. Usually it is C:/Programs Files/Worms 4 Mayhem or somewhat similar to that. In installation folder, there is DATA folder and all tweaks go there. Simple as that Smile
